Hi All - I could really use your help. The Scenario:

I have a BCM 400 that has scheduled services set up.

DAY: all incoming calls ring a 'ring group' and after 6 rings goes to Auto Attendant.

NIGHT: It currently rings a different ring group, but only rings once and then goes to the voice mail of one of the ring group members.

I need the night mode to right that different group 6 times and then go to auto attendant.

Any ideas what I'm missing?
Thank You

 
Check the members ext out that is going to voicemail and find out why. Is this ext cfwd to the vmail dn? Is the ext set to fwd on busy to vmail? Im sure it's something easy to figure out.

When programming ring services you are not creating a new seperate group but adding on to the day group.

If you want a seperate group for night you have to reverse the groups, be in night mode during the day and day mode at night.
